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Supertech Cape Town

4 years ago

ID: #650242

Business Description

Supertech Cape Town provides top properties with each possible service and so you don't have to go out of the township for refreshment. These apartments are well ventilated, large and laced with all current features.

No Review.

Please login / register to add your review.